Visual C ++库DLL是否已本地化?

时间:2010-12-13 18:10:44

标签: c++ windows deployment localization runtime

我们在Windows上部署c ++应用程序时包含Visual C ++运行时库,即使用Microsoft_VC90_CRT_x86.msm等合并模块。

在定位其他语言(西班牙语,葡萄牙语,德语等)时,我们是否需要这些库的本地化版本,或者它们是通用的?

如果您可以“直接从源头”提供链接,那将是最有帮助的。任何实践经验也是受欢迎的。

2 个答案:

答案 0 :(得分:3)

MFC有本地化的DLL和合并模块来安装合适的DLL:http://msdn.microsoft.com/en-us/library/ms235264.aspx

主要的Visual C ++运行时似乎没有。

答案 1 :(得分:2)

CRT无法本地化。有一些错误消息,都是用#define语句用英文硬编码的。你可以在crt \ src \ cmsgs.h中找到它们

用户唯一有责任看到的是

  

此应用程序已请求   运行时以异常方式终止它   方式。
请联系   应用程序的支持团队了解更多信息   信息。

无用的消息,翻译它并不会使它更清晰。